In a Punnett square, a capital letter represents what type of allele?
- A. Dominant.
- B. Ryeesive.
- C. Homozygous.
- D. Heterozygous.
Correct Answer: A
Rationale: Correct Answer: A: Dominant.
Rationale:
1. In a Punnett square, capital letters denote dominant alleles.
2. Dominant alleles are expressed in the phenotype over recessive alleles.
3. This representation helps predict the possible offspring genotypes.
4. Choice B is incorrect as it's a misspelling of 'Recessive.'
5. Choices C and D refer to genotype combinations, not allele types.
Summary:
The capital letter in a Punnett square signifies a dominant allele that will be expressed in the offspring's phenotype. This helps in predicting genetic outcomes accurately.

What substances make up the bilayer of the cellular membrane?
- A. Nucleic acids
- B. Phospholipids
- C. Proteins
- D. Carbohydrates
Correct Answer: B
Rationale: The cellular membrane consists of a bilayer of phospholipids. This phospholipid bilayer forms a flexible barrier around the cell, providing structural integrity and fluidity. While proteins and carbohydrates are also present in the cell membrane, the main component of the membrane's structure is the phospholipid bilayer, which plays a crucial role in maintaining the cell's functions.
In a population of dogs, fur color is controlled by two alleles: black (B) and tan (b). The black allele shows complete dominance. If a dog has a tan fur phenotype, what is its genotype?
- A. BB
- B. Bb
- C. bb
- D. Not enough information
Correct Answer: C
Rationale: If a dog displays a tan fur phenotype, it indicates that the dog possesses two tan alleles, represented by the genotype bb. In this case, the dog cannot have any black alleles (B) since the black allele demonstrates complete dominance over the tan allele. Therefore, the correct genotype for a dog with a tan fur phenotype is bb.
What part of a light microscope is used to hold the slide in place?
- A. Base
- B. Arm
- C. Rack stop
- D. Stage clips
Correct Answer: D
Rationale: The correct answer is 'Stage clips.' Stage clips are utilized to secure the slide on the stage of a light microscope, ensuring it remains in position while examining the specimen. The base of the microscope provides stability, the arm supports the upper part of the microscope, and the rack stop restricts the movement of the stage. However, specifically, it is the stage clips that hold the slide in place during observations.
